Myelin basic protein antibody - 295 003

MBP is a major component of the myelin sheath
Rabbit polyclonal purified antibody

Cat. No. 295 003 50 µg specific antibody, lyophilized. Affinity purified with the immunogen. Albumin was added for stabilization. For reconstitution add 50 µl H2O to get a 1mg/ml solution in PBS. Then aliquot and store at -20°C to -80°C until use.
Antibodies should be stored at +4°C when still lyophilized. Do not freeze!

Immunogen Synthetic peptide corresponding to AA 105 to 115 from rat MBP (UniProt Id: P02688)
Reactivity Reacts with: human (P02686), rat (P02688), mouse (P04370).
Other species not tested yet.
Specificity Specific for MBP. Epitope is present in all splice variants.
Matching control protein/peptide 295-0P
Remarks

IHC: Heat-mediated antigen retrieval (in citrate buffer pH 6) is required for immunohistochemical staining.

Background
The myelin sheath is a multi-layered membrane composed of several proteins like PLP, claudin 11 and myelin basic protein (MBP) which is specific for the nervous system. MBP functions as an insulator and increases the velocity of axonal impulse conduction.
MBP can be subdivided into the classic group consisting of isoforms 4 to 14 and the non-classic group of MBP comprising the Golli MBPs (isoforms 1 to 3). Differential splicing events and optional posttranslational modifications give rise to a wide spectrum of isomers with potentially specialized functions.
